Windows Movie Maker

I thought that even though I had finished the assessment, I had better keep updating this Blog with my new experiences with technology. On my latest prac visit in a school, I had the experience of using Windows movie maker to make animations. The students had taken pictures and used the pictures to create an animation advertisement clip. The end affect looked great. I found this program great to use, however it was very slow on the computer we were using to edit the program. I found that the program was very similar to power point in some ways because you could add different features and customize each picture. I found this program easy to navigate my way around and so did the students. They were excited to see their still pictures being turned into a short clip. They were proud of what they created and we able to share their work with others.
